Here is the source code for org.caleydo.view.imageviewer.internal.ImageViewerViewPart.java

Source

/*******************************************************************************
 * Caleydo - Visualization for Molecular Biology - http://caleydo.org
 * Copyright (c) The Caleydo Team. All rights reserved.
 * Licensed under the new BSD license, available at http://caleydo.org/license
 ******************************************************************************/
package org.caleydo.view.imageviewer.internal;

import java.util.List;

import org.caleydo.core.data.datadomain.DataDomainManager;
import org.caleydo.core.data.datadomain.IDataDomain;
import org.caleydo.core.event.ADirectedEvent;
import org.caleydo.core.event.EventPublisher;
import org.caleydo.core.view.ARcpGLElementViewPart;
import org.caleydo.core.view.opengl.canvas.IGLCanvas;
import org.caleydo.core.view.opengl.layout2.AGLElementView;
import org.caleydo.datadomain.image.ImageDataDomain;
import org.caleydo.datadomain.image.LayeredImage;
import org.caleydo.view.imageviewer.internal.serial.SerializedImageViewerView;
import org.eclipse.jface.action.ControlContribution;
import org.eclipse.jface.action.IToolBarManager;
import org.eclipse.swt.SWT;
import org.eclipse.swt.events.SelectionAdapter;
import org.eclipse.swt.events.SelectionEvent;
import org.eclipse.swt.layout.RowLayout;
import org.eclipse.swt.widgets.Combo;
import org.eclipse.swt.widgets.Composite;
import org.eclipse.swt.widgets.Control;

/**
 *
 * @author Thomas Geymayer
 *
 */
public class ImageViewerViewPart extends ARcpGLElementViewPart {

    protected ImageSelector imageSelector;

    public ImageViewerViewPart() {
        super(SerializedImageViewerView.class);
    }

    @Override
    protected AGLElementView createView(IGLCanvas canvas) {
        return new ImageViewerView(glCanvas);
    }

    @Override
    public void addToolBarContent(IToolBarManager toolBarManager) {
        toolBarManager.add(imageSelector = new ImageSelector());
        toolBarManager.update(true);
    }

    // TODO update on view.init()
    // imageSelector.onImageChange();

    public static class SelectImageEvent extends ADirectedEvent {

        public LayeredImage image;

        public SelectImageEvent(LayeredImage img) {
            image = img;
        }

        @Override
        public boolean checkIntegrity() {
            return image != null;
        }

    }

    protected class ImageSelector extends ControlContribution {

        Combo domainCombo;
        Combo imageCombo;

        public ImageSelector() {
            super("ImageSelector");
        }

        public ImageDataDomain getSelectedDomain() {
            List<IDataDomain> domains = getDomains();
            int selectionIndex = domainCombo.getSelectionIndex();
            if (selectionIndex < 0 || selectionIndex >= domains.size())
                return null;
            return (ImageDataDomain) domains.get(selectionIndex);
        }

        public LayeredImage getSelectedImage() {
            ImageDataDomain dataDomain = getSelectedDomain();
            if (dataDomain == null)
                return null;
            return dataDomain.getImageSet().getImage(imageCombo.getText());
        }

        public void onDomainChange() {
            imageCombo.removeAll();
            imageCombo.setEnabled(true);

            ImageDataDomain imageSet = getSelectedDomain();
            if (imageSet == null)
                return;

            for (String name : imageSet.getImageSet().getImageNames())
                imageCombo.add(name);
            imageCombo.select(0);

            onImageChange();
        }

        public void onImageChange() {
            LayeredImage img = getSelectedImage();
            if (img == null)
                return;
            EventPublisher.trigger(new SelectImageEvent(img).to(((ImageViewerView) getView()).getImageViewer()));
        }

        @Override
        protected Control createControl(Composite parent) {

            final int comboStyle = SWT.NONE | SWT.READ_ONLY | SWT.DROP_DOWN;

            final Composite composite = new Composite(parent, SWT.NULL);
            RowLayout layout = new RowLayout();
            composite.setLayout(layout);

            domainCombo = new Combo(composite, comboStyle);
            imageCombo = new Combo(composite, comboStyle);

            domainCombo.addSelectionListener(new SelectionAdapter() {
                @Override
                public void widgetSelected(SelectionEvent e) {
                    onDomainChange();
                }
            });

            imageCombo.addSelectionListener(new SelectionAdapter() {
                @Override
                public void widgetSelected(SelectionEvent e) {
                    onImageChange();
                }
            });
            imageCombo.add("<no image>");
            imageCombo.select(0);
            imageCombo.setEnabled(false);

            for (IDataDomain dataDomain : getDomains())
                domainCombo.add(dataDomain.getLabel());
            domainCombo.select(0);

            onDomainChange();

            return composite;
        }

        protected List<IDataDomain> getDomains() {
            return DataDomainManager.get().getDataDomainsByType(ImageDataDomain.DATA_DOMAIN_TYPE);
        }
    }
}
